Rules of conduct on the water in a cruise

Sea cruise liners are today one of the safest modes of transport. Shipping companies invest millions in their business, as security requirements are increasing every year. For example, recently, the operation of vessels with lift only on elevators from the lower decks was prohibited, since the elevator may not work when de-energized. Ways of evacuation must pass along the gangways and be designated as glowing in the dark by special signs.

Rescue means of one side of any vessel are designed to save all people, both passengers and crew members. However, the rules of behavior on the water prescribe that in the first 24 hours of the cruise there should be a training alarm.

In a printed form, the safety instruction is on the door of the cabin. Life jackets in the right amount - in the wardrobe of the cabin.

You will be told how the alarm sounds, and after a while will give such a signal. Usually it's 7 short beeps, followed by one long beep.

Be serious about the training alarm! Of course, the likelihood of all this you need - is negligible, but to practice, putting on a life jacket, and remember the shortest path to the desired rescue station is definitely worth it. The training alarm will last no more than half an hour. On some ships a roll call of those present, and for "the unconscious" they arrange an additional educational alarm. And it does not depend the first time you are on a cruise or in the 10th.

Rules of conduct on the water in Russia for the first time released the "Society of Rescue on the Water", organized in 1872 year. They still sound actual today:

- You can not swim, and even more so dive in unsuitable places;
- do not swim further than the buoys;
- Do not approach the water to ships and boats;
- no games with a comic "drowning";
- Do not go into the water in a state of intoxication;

- be vigilant when using inflatable appliances;

Safety rules on water:

The water temperature should be at least 19 degrees Celsius. The time in the water should be increased gradually within reasonable limits. The rules of behavior on the water say: in no case do not jump from the shore - you can get a serious injury by hitting the stone. Do not swim too far - you can overestimate your strength.

And a few tips. Charter, you should turn over on your back and "relax" on the water. If captured by a strong current - do not try to overcome it. The correct tactic is to swim downstream, with a small angle towards the shore. Once in the maelstrom, you should get air into the lungs, dive and, when you ascend, make a jerk to the side with all your might. Another extreme situation - muscle cramp: you swim and suddenly feel - reduces your leg. Pull forcefully, grabbing your thumb, feet on yourself. This usually helps.

And the last thing - learn to swim and learn to swim your children. Of course, many good swimmers are drowning, but a person who knows how to stay well on the water, feels much more confident. And this is very important!
